### Step 4: Load test the checkout flow

Before cutting Cartfell traffic over, run the synthetic checkout suite against the new cluster. Ramp to 400 RPS over ten minutes; abort if p99 exceeds 900 ms. Payment stubs must be enabled — never hit the live gateway. Apply the load-generator settings exactly as listed below.

settings of tagef-bawif:
DRUIX_HOST=druix.zemvarlabs.internal
DRUIX_PORT=8000

Runbook 4.2 — Outbound: archive film reels

Shift lead actions for reel shipments to the Wrenhollow Archive: confirm each crate from the Calderfen vault carries an intact humidity strip; reject any crate reading above the amber band. Stage crates in the shaded lane, never the sun-exposed apron, and limit staging to ninety minutes. Book only the Faraday Haulage chilled van — standard vans are not approved for nitrate stock. When the driver presents, execute the confidential hand-over instruction set out immediately below.

dispatch memo: the eliath belael courier leaves the praox ledger at gate 8841 under passcode 017589

### Handover: Calendar Sync Conflict

Support team: the Drift duplicate-event issue stems from Brightmere Calendar writing conflicting revision stamps during two-way sync. Workaround is documented in the runbook — disable push sync, purge the shadow cache, re-enable. Do not delete user events manually. For escalations requiring a data repair, route tickets directly to the engineer named below.

named custodian: Oliath Ralax

## Archiving Cold Storage Buckets — Approval Process

Before archiving any cold storage bucket in the Frostvale platform, support staff must confirm the bucket has had zero reads for 180 days and that no retention holds are active. File an archive request in the Glacierline queue, attach the access report, and wait for written approval before proceeding. Archives are irreversible after the 30-day grace window, so double-check the bucket identifier against the customer record. All approvals must be signed off by the archive steward named below.

account owner for bawip-tahag: Raleth Quenok